USB Controller issue on Dimension 2350

I installed the drivers for a USB Printer, with no problems.   But I cannot print.   When I look in Device Manager, next to ISB it has a question mark.   Can anyone assist me in finding the USB drivers for Dimenstion 2350?  
 
I looked on Dell site and do not see USB drivers for Dim 2350. 
 
My Operating System is Windows XP Professional.
 
Any assistance you can give me would be greately appreciated.

Try installing the latest chipset drivers. That covers the USB.

No, there is no separate driver just for USB. Now, the question is, why won't it install? You might try disabling your A/V for a moment.
